Job Description

The Security Officer works under the supervision of the DIRECTOR – Security and the Security Managers. The Security Officer is responsible for maintaining a safe and secure environment for all persons, equipment, and physical property of Mosaic Life Care.

Responsibilities
  • Conducting patrols of the buildings and grounds, ensuring adequate access control and protection of caregivers and all Mosaic Life Care properties, and able to respond to an armed threat, and bring a safe resolution to the threat or situation..
  • Conducting inspections of the facilities looking for unsafe acts and/or conditions, which threaten life safety.
  • Able to operate in a stressful environment where person/persons have experienced life threating injuries and death.
  • Controlling persons experiencing behavior that is unacceptable via non-violent physical crisis intervention techniques (CPI) or the approved Force Continuum action, or other accepted practices dependent upon the circumstances.
  • Participating in positive public relations activities by providing assistance with information, directions, and vehicles management.
  • Documenting activities and reports on a daily basis, providing information to the leadership. Officers will maintain all equipment and vehicles in a constant state of readiness.
  • Coordinating traffic and crowd control during emergency situations and provide direction as necessary or requested.
  • Respond and investigate incidents in a timely manner and effectively document the facts of the case, take photos of the crime scene and secure any evidence.
  • Direct and or assist Security Officer (I) in the performance of their duties during their shift.
  • Other duties as assigned
Education
  • H.S. Diploma - GED or HiSET equivalent - Required
  • Two years college preferably in criminal justice, or Fire Safety and or Post Certified Police Academy - Preferred
Work Experience
  • 2 Years - Position dealing with the public, preferably in the Law Enforcement, Fire Safety, Military Security, Federal (DHS Department of Homeland Security) - Required
Licenses and Certifications
  • Driver's License - Valid In State - Chauffeurs license or ability to obtain valid chauffeur’s driver`s - Required within 90 Days Or
  • Driver's License - Valid In State - Minimum class E chauffeurs license - Required Upon Hire
  • Must complete the International Association of Hospital Safety and Security basic Security Officer Exam - Required within 120 Days
Travel Requirements
  • Must be able to travel between various system facilities and off-site locations as needed. - Required
Essential Technical/Motor Skills
  • Must be able to gather information and formulate an accurate, detailed report based on factual accounts of a case.
  • Able to calm excited callers and take good written information, transfers calls appropriately, and have good hand/eye coordination.
Interpersonal Skills
  • Must be able to communicate directions, policies, and procedures, in a coherent fashion to eliminate misunderstandings of what is being requested by the officer.
  • Ability to transform information from memory, and or notes into a written document.
Essential Physical Requirements
  • Must be capable of foot patrol of entire campus (inside and out). Respond to alarms; capable of standing in the elements; must have ability to run to assist caregivers, visitors, etc. if person is in trouble.
  • Physically restrain/subdue violent and combative people, at times for several minutes.
  • Assist nursing with lifting heavy patients in rooms and from vehicles.
  • Control mental health patients on the unit and during vehicle trips to court, state facility, or other campus.
  • After new job applicants reviews this job description with their Primary Care Physician (PCP) the PCP will give written clearance for the job applicant to complete the following essential functions test which is a condition of employment: Running up two flights of steps (108 steps) in 20 seconds.
  • Moving a 145 pound dummy 25 feet, able to complete 20 sit ups in 50 seconds and 20 push-ups in 50 seconds.
  • Recruit must be able to safely handle/grip the unit approved firearm.
  • Be able to successfully complete the Mosaic Security Officer’s Firearm Course.
Essential Mental Abilities
  • Capable of remembering facts and commit to writing.
  • High stress requires both physical and mental strength and situation will escalated. Must develop high skill level with training/education.
  • Handle emergency situations such as first responder to fires, patients losing body fluids, and criminal activity.
  • As a condition of employment, all job applicants must be able to view a mock scenario and meet the minimum requirements for recording the essential facts of the investigation.
  • All Recruits must pass the mental evaluation to prove fit to carry a firearm by a licensed psychologist provided by the organization.
Essential Sensory Requirements
  • As a condition of employment, all job applicants must have good vision (corrected to 20/40 or better) for their own protection and that of others.
  • Must meet and maintain the minimum requirements for color blind, distance vision and hearing test physical fitness test.
  • Capable of smelling smoke, fumes, etc.
Exposure to Hazards
  • Weather elements, hazardous materials, hazardous gases, body fluids, and combative individuals.
